* This fixes the avatar stuck in objects on login and teleport by gently applying an upward motion when stuck in things on the Z

* Comments describe how it filters out good, normal collisions, from 'stuck' collisions..   It's especially sensitive in feetbox collisions since this is where normal collisions happen under usual circumstances.
